<strong>Chemical</strong> <strong>Resistance</strong> <strong>of</strong> VYDYNE <strong>Nylon</strong> Resins (<strong>Nylon</strong> <strong>66</strong>)The following abbreviations areused for the ratings:E = ExcellentG = GoodF = FairP = PoorNR = Not RecommendedS = SolventTable 1 – Behavior <strong>of</strong> VYDYNE® <strong>Nylon</strong> Resins (<strong>Nylon</strong> <strong>66</strong>) Toward Organic Solventsat Room TemperatureReagent Visual Change RatingsBenzyl Alcohol Coarse Surface After 2 Days NRButyl Alcohol Temporary loss <strong>of</strong> stiffness GEthyl Alcohol Temporary loss <strong>of</strong> stiffness GEthylene Glycol Temporary loss <strong>of</strong> stiffness GIsopropyl Alcohol Temporary loss <strong>of</strong> stiffness GMethyl Alcohol Temporary loss <strong>of</strong> stiffness GButyl Acetate Unchanged EEthyl Acetate Unchanged EMethyl Acetate Unchanged EAmyl Acetate Unchanged EEther (Diethyl) Unchanged ETetrahydr<strong>of</strong>uran Unchanged EAcetone Unchanged EBenzaldyhyde Unchanged ECyclohexanone Unchanged EDichlorethylene Temporary loss <strong>of</strong> stiffness GTrichlorethylene Temporary loss <strong>of</strong> stiffness GPerchlorethylene Unchanged EDichlormethane Temporary loss <strong>of</strong> stiffness GChlor<strong>of</strong>orm Temporary loss <strong>of</strong> stiffness GCarbon Tetrachloride Unchanged ECarbon Disulfide Unchanged EPyridine Unchanged EBenzene Unchanged EMonochlorbenzene Unchanged EToluene Unchanged EXylene Unchanged EKerosene Unchanged ETurpentine Unchanged ETetralin Unchanged EDecalin Unchanged EGasoline Unchanged EPetroleum Unchanged EMineral Oil Unchanged EResorcinol Dissolves S, NR


Table 2 – Behavior <strong>of</strong> VYDYNE <strong>Nylon</strong> Resins (<strong>Nylon</strong> <strong>66</strong>) TowardAcids, Bases, Halogens, etc.Reagent Temp Visual Change Ratings°F (°C)Sulfuric Acid (Conc) 75(24) Dissolves S, NRSulfuric Acid (Dilute) 75(24) Partially dissolves P, NRHydrochloric Acid(Conc) 75(24) Dissolves S, NRHydrochloric Acid(Dilute) 75(24) Partially dissolves P, NRHydrochloric Acid(20-40%) 73(23) Etched after 1 sec. P, NRPhosphoric Acid(Conc) 75(24) Dissolves S, NRNitric Acid (Conc) 75(24) Dissolves S, NRAcetic Acid (Conc) 75(24) Partially dissolves P, NRAcetic Acid (Conc) 200(93) Dissolves S, NRAcetic Acid (Dilute) 75(24) Etched F, NRFormic Acid (Conc) 75(24) Dissolves S, NRFormic Acid (Dilute) 75(24) Partially dissolves P, NRChlorine — Strong attack NRBromine — Strong attack NRPhenol 75(24) Dissolves S, NR0-Chlorophenol 75(24) Dissolves S, NRm-Chlorophenol 75(24) Dissolves S, NRp-Chlorophenol 75(24) Dissolves S, NRCresol 75(24) Dissolves S, NRDimethylformamide 75(24) Strong attack NRgamma-Butyrolactone 75(24) Strong attack NRXylenols 75(24) Dissolves S, NRSodium Hydroxide (5%) 73(23) Minimal effect ESodium Hydroxide (5%) 158(70) Minimal effect ESodium Hydroxide (10%) 73(23) Minimal effect ESodium HydroxideSome “crazing”(10%) 158(70) after 30 days P, NRPotassium Hydroxide(5%) 73(23) Minimal effect EPotassium Hydroxide(5%) 158(70) Minimal effect EPotassium Hydroxide(10%) 73(23) Minimal effect EPotassium HydroxideSome “crazing”(10%) 158(70) after 30 days P, NRTable 3 – Behavior <strong>of</strong> VYDYNE <strong>Nylon</strong> Resins(<strong>Nylon</strong> <strong>66</strong>) in Aqueous Solutions <strong>of</strong> Inorganic Salts atRoom TemperatureSalt Solution Visual Change Ratings10% Ammonium Chloride Unchanged F10% Aluminum Chloride Unchanged F10% Sodium Hypochlorite White coating(0.1% Cl) after 18 days G10% Calcium Chloride Unchanged F10% Chrome Alum Unchanged G10% Ferric Chloride Unchangedyellowing P, NR5% Potassium Dichromate Unchangedyellowing P, NR10% Potassium Nitrate Unchanged G1% PotassiumPermanganate Decomposed NR10% Copper Sulfate Unchanged G10% Magnesium Chloride Unchanged G10% Manganese Sulfate Unchanged G10% Sodium Sulfate Unchanged G10% Sodium Bisulfite Unchanged G5% Mercuric Chloride Swelled P5% Sodium Hydroxide Etched G1% Sodium Hydroxide Unchanged G0.5% Hydrogen Peroxide Unchanged G1% Hydrogen Peroxide Brittle after54 days NR3% Hydrogen Peroxide Brittle after54 days NR10% Hydrogen Peroxide Degrades NR30% Hydrogen Peroxide Degrades NR10% Zinc Chloride Unchanged F
